Celtic has ‘No Plans’ to Sign Anyone before Astana

CELTIC ASSISTANT MANAGER, Chris Davies today told the media that Celtic has ‘no plans’ to sign anyone else before they take on FC Astana in a double header.

Many fans who were hopeful the club would go above and beyond to make their Champions League dream a reality will be left disappointed with Davies’ admission.

Celtic have been progressing nicely and the board and manager must feel they have enough at the moment to get into the group stages.

If they do manage to get past FC Astana like they did last year with a weaker side, then all eyes will be on the club to make sure they leave no stone unturned to make sure the squad is good enough to compete in this year’s competition.

Qualification is by no means a guarantee.
